Rafi Peer's Faizan Peerzada dies at 54

Theatre director Peerzada died of a heart attack.


Sher Khan December 21, 2012

LAHORE: Director of the Rafi Peer Theatre Workshop Faizan Peerzada passed away in Lahore on Friday.

According to doctors, 54-year-old Faizan died of a heart attack.

Faizan’s sister Tasneem Peerzada, while speaking to The Express Tribune, said her brother never had a heart problem before and that this was his first heart attack.

“It happened suddenly,” she said.

Faizan was a National College of Arts graduate and had held around 60 exhibitions – local and international.
